Morgan Advanced Ceramics WDS® Granulate Porextherm
Categories: Ceramic; Oxide; Silicon Oxide

Material Notes: Description: WDS® Granulate is a microporous insulation material which has an extremely low thermal conductivity coefficient giving it very good insulating properties. WDS® Granulate consists of inorganic silicates. The main constituent is fumed silica; the other components are infrared opacifiers. WDS® Granulate is non-flammable and meets the requirements of DIN EN 13501-1; part 1, A1.

Application: WDS® Granulate is a free-flowing WDS® grade that offers excellent insulating properties. It is specially developed for filling insulation panels. The inorganic granules are specially modified for the filling of voids and spaces of complex geometry.

Physical P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
Density 0.110 - 0.135 g/ccnominal
 0.130 - 0.160 g/cctapped, at AAW_843-00
 0.180 - 0.220 g/ccvibration, at ASW_843-01
 
Thermal P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
Thermal Conductivity 0.0250 W/m-K
@Temperature 22.5 °C
165 kg/m3; ASTM C177
 0.0260 W/m-K
@Temperature 50.0 °C
200 kg/m3; ASTM C177
 0.0270 W/m-K
@Temperature 200 °C
200 kg/m3; ASTM C177
 0.0350 W/m-K
@Temperature 400 °C
200 kg/m3; ASTM C177
 0.0490 W/m-K
@Temperature 600 °C
200 kg/m3; ASTM C177
 0.0680 W/m-K
@Temperature 800 °C
200 kg/m3; ASTM C177
Maximum Service Temperature, Air <= 950 °C
 
Component Elements P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
SiC 30 %
SiO2 70 %
 
Descriptive Properties
Classification Temperature (°C)1000
Colorgrey
